Measure where it matters......at the Uhle boxes
Available Uhle box vacuum can differ tremendously from the pump vacuum. Pipe (contamination), valves and other consumers connected to the same system will influence the vacuum at every position.
Therefore, if you want to check to check the vacuum at the Uhle boxes there is only one place to measure...
Checking and setting the vacuum the Uhle box vacuum
With the Feltest realVac it is easy to compare the vacuum on both tender and drive side of the machine. Several factors can cause differences between the vacuum on both sides. It is a helpfull tool to set the vacuum valve on-site when there is no manometer available nearby or as a check to available manometers.

Quickly determine the openess of a press felt
With the Feltest AirSpeed one can quickly measure the air speed through a felt over a Uhle box. Only in combination with the measured real vacuum one will get an adequate impression of the felts openess.

Quickly determine vacuum anywhere
a small drilled hole ( Ø 9 mm) is enough to gain access to any desired measuring point. Checking your complete vacuum system on a regular base can be done in no time. This enables full controle over your vacuum system.
